Issue 79682

Summary: WW8: Loop opening DOC containing many/large tables
Product: Writer Reporter: januszzz <janusz>
Component: open-importAssignee: michael.ruess
Status: CLOSED FIXED QA Contact: issues@sw <issues>
Severity: Trivial    
Priority: P2 CC: issues
Version: OOo 2.2.1Keywords: regression
Target Milestone: ---   
Hardware: All   
OS: All   
Issue Type: DEFECT Latest Confirmation in: ---
Developer Difficulty: ---
Attachments:
Description Flags
File which hangs OO 2.2.1
none
XML file from MS Word 2003 which hang OO 2.2.1
none
repaired bugdoc none

Description januszzz 2007-07-17 07:44:41 UTC
Hi,

as in subject - OO crashes on some doc or xml. There is no easy way to
reproduce, but I include docs that halts it.

Story:
I created a doc file using Microsoft Word 97, then moved it to her Gentoo
machine and used it for a while. Although it still was doc, OO handled it perfectly.

Yesterday I closed the file, and OO did not manage to open it again.So I opened
it in MS, saved as doc again. Still OO hangs. OK, I've saved it as Microsoft
Word XML - and the same, OO hangs. So I saved it as RTF - ok, OO opens it.

Additionaly I tried Google Apps to open the doc - without luck, but I'm newbie
(& was on hurry) on Google Apps so I may have missed sth.

Subcomponent:
I suspect saving/opening?

OS:
I tried OO 32/64 bit versions - Gentoo standard ebuild and compiled by me, as
well as 32 bit Windows Version.

Priority:
this is serious - I had to use Microsoft. Without it I would lost my document.
OO was completely unusable (I know, I had MS binary format, but later I got also
an XML!!)

If you got any further questions please do not hesitate contacting me, I will
try to provide any feedback.

Januszzz

ps. Howto attach a file?
Comment 1 januszzz 2007-07-17 07:49:10 UTC
Created attachment 46850 [details]
File which hangs OO 2.2.1
Comment 2 januszzz 2007-07-17 07:51:46 UTC
Created attachment 46851 [details]
XML file from MS Word 2003 which hang OO 2.2.1
Comment 3 januszzz 2007-07-17 07:53:46 UTC
Files attached.
Comment 4 michael.ruess 2007-07-17 10:22:35 UTC
MRU->FME: open attached doc -> loop
the document contains many large tables (~30 pages).
Comment 5 frank.meies 2007-07-17 11:58:51 UTC
fme->januszzz: Row 26-81 of the last table in this document have their height
set to "exactly 0.01cm". This makes Writer choke. I'll attach a 'fixed' version
of your bugdoc.
Comment 6 frank.meies 2007-07-17 11:59:54 UTC
Created attachment 46858 [details]
repaired bugdoc
Comment 7 januszzz 2007-07-17 12:27:30 UTC
Fine, it works, although I'm not sure if I ever touched rows height. And MS 
handles the doc perfectly, so I guess Writer has some issues with that. 

Thanks.

Januszzz.
Comment 8 frank.meies 2007-09-05 09:02:13 UTC
Loop does not occur anymore due to the implementation of some general loop
controls in the Writer layout engine, see issue 81146.
Comment 9 januszzz 2007-09-05 09:55:27 UTC
I do not understand ? :-)

In which version this bug will be RESOLVED? target milestone 2.4? As long as I 
know my 2.2.1 still hangs on the doc & xml?
Comment 10 frank.meies 2007-09-05 10:09:03 UTC
fme->januszzz: This has been fixed in cws loopcontrol. This cws is targeted for
OOo 2.4 and not yet integrated. You can check the state of this cws here:

http://eis.services.openoffice.org/EIS2/cws.ShowCWS?Path=SRC680%2Floopcontrol
Comment 11 januszzz 2007-09-05 10:16:25 UTC
OK, no more questions, THANKS!
Comment 12 frank.meies 2007-09-10 13:38:17 UTC
fme->mru: Ready for QA.
Comment 13 michael.ruess 2007-09-18 09:17:21 UTC
Verified in CWS loopcontrol.
Comment 14 michael.ruess 2007-10-31 12:35:48 UTC
Checked fix in SRC680m235 build.